Detailed description
The objective of this clinical study is to investigate the effects and mechanisms of transcranial alternating current stimulation (tACS) on neural modulation in the right temporoparietal junction (rTPJ) of autism spectrum disorders. The primary inquiry it seeks to address is the impact of tACS the treatment of autism spectrum disorders (ASD) through its influence on the rTPJ . Participants will undergo baseline assessments of clinical symptoms and cognitive levels, utilize electroencephalography (EEG) to monitor brain electrical activity during both resting and task states, analyze EEG neurophysiological characteristics, use eye tracking technology to collect data on participants' eye movements during cognitive tasks, employ functional magnetic resonance spectroscopy (fMRS) to detect neurotransmitters such as glutamate + glutamine (Glx), GABA+ macromolecules (GABA+) and taurine in resting state and Theory of Mind task, as well as utilize magnetic resonance imaging (MRI) to detect and analyze functional connectivity and synchronous activation of relevant brain regions during both resting state and task state. Following completion of baseline assessment and examination, participants will be randomly assigned into two groups: a 40 Hz tACS group and a sham stimulation group with 30 patients in each group for a total of 60 patients. Subjects in the tACS group will receive tACS intervention at 2.0mA with a frequency of 40Hz while subjects in the sham group will receive placebo stimulation at a similar location and frequency with no current between periods. Standardized assessment tools along with Theory of Mind tasks will be utilized to evaluate multidimensional changes in clinical symptoms and cognitive levels post-intervention. Additionally, EEG will again be used to monitor brain electrical activity during both resting and task states by analyzing functional E/I values (fE/I) as well as indicators of EEG oscillatory activity such as α- power, γ-power etc., Eye tracker data analysis will also be conducted again for changes in eye fixation during cognitive tasks while fMRS analysis will focus on changes in neurotransmitters. Furthermore, MRI analysis post-intervention aims to examine changes in functional connectivity along with synchronous activation within rTPJ region alongside related brain regions once more. Researchers aim to validate the efficacy \& safety profile associated with 40 Hz tACS intervention within rTPJ for treating social impairment observed within ASD population whilst exploring biological indicators \& mechanisms underlying effective treatment strategies involving 40 Hz tACS intervention program.

Interventions
| Type | Name | Description |
|---|---|---|
| DEVICE | 40 Hz tACS intervention | The central electrode is placed in the CP6 and the other four electrodes are placed around the CP6. 40 Hz tACS group participants will receive alternating current stimulation (40Hz, 2.0mA, 20min/time, three times a day, 21 times in total) for 1 week. Subjects in the placebo comparator group will receive sham tACS for 1 week, which mimics the tACS intervention in terms of electrode placement and session frequency. However, the device will deliver a 0mA current, ensuring no actual stimulation occurs. |
